Output d8b81b6e2e31201dff2f814c2231960251c0317e3b8dad3580876d70ffe32d86:1

value
17276781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6eeb22c86ed6c25f5fc148ddf52c08fb9e976cc2 OP_EQUAL
address
3BoVwAvGXNcsV9McPKv2vRC26U5E23SHiu
transaction
d8b81b6e2e31201dff2f814c2231960251c0317e3b8dad3580876d70ffe32d86
spent
true